WebWake Forest University played home games in the stadium from its move to Winston-Salem in 1956, until the 1968 season when Groves Stadium (now Truist Field at Wake Forest) opened. Players such as Brian Piccolo, the 1964 ACC Player of the Year who led the nation in rushing and scoring, played their home games in Bowman Gray.

Some of the changes... taxing childless peopleCameron Indoor Stadium is an indoor arena located on the campus of Duke University in Durham, North Carolina. The 9,314-seat facility is the primary indoor athletic venue for the Duke Blue Devils and serves as the home court for Duke men's and women's basketball and women's volleyball.
